Notes
The Range Active Fuel Management Disable Device cannot be used in conjunction with aftermarket tuners that need to remain attached to the diagnostic port.
The Range AFM Disable Device is NOT a programmer and does NOT change the ECU's mapping or memory locations. It is a dynamic interactive device that actually participates on the vehicle's communication line (bus) and revises the way the ECU uses its STOCK calibration to lock it in V8 mode. Since the Range AFM Disable Device does not change the factory programming in any way, your vehicle will still comply with the factory certified emissions profile.

2010 Lotus Evora to start at $74,675

Mon, 16 Nov 2009

The 2010 Lotus Evora will start at $74,675 when it arrives in the United States in the first part of next year. The exotic mid-engine 2+2 sports car is powered by a 3.5-liter V6 rated at 276 hp and 258 lb-ft of torque. It rips from 0 to 60 mph in 4.9 seconds and tops out at 162 mph.

More Saab products coming, Muller says

Thu, 05 Aug 2010

Saab's new Dutch owner, Spyker Cars NV, intends to spin additional models off its new Phoenix platform after it yields a redesigned Saab 9-3. Saab dealers will receive the latest 9-3 in 2012, Spyker founder and Saab Automobile AB Chairman Victor Muller said Thursday at the CAR Management Briefing Seminars in Traverse City, Mich. The dealers, who have been starved for product as former owner General Motors attempted to sell or liquidate the brand, also will obtain a Cadillac-based 9-4X crossover when it goes into production in April 2011 in Mexico.
